软件开发流程分析:
一、需求分析
相关人员向用户初步了解需求,并将这些需求记录下来,app制作公司,再根据软件的核心功能,确定需求的优先级。根据确定好具体所需的功能模块,对于有些需求比较明确相关的界面时,在这一步里面可以初步定义好少量的界面。对需求深入了解和分析后,乌鲁木齐APP开发,需要列出系统大致的大功能模块,并且还需列出相关的界面和界面功能。
二、设计
在需求以及功能模块都确定好后,企业需要对整个软件进行设计。设计包括模块划分、功能分配以及UI/UE的设计等。在风格的设计上要统一,如果定的基调是清新,那么整体设计就要小清新,只有设计统一才会让用户觉得舒服。
三、编码
根据此前做好的功能模块以及设计进行程序编写工作,需要将此前的设计都变成现实,可在手记上呈现。一般来说,程序编码工作的时间不会超过整体流程时间的一半,大多数在1/3的时间就可将编码工作完成。设计得好,程序员写程序的效率会大大提高。
品牌
品牌是应用设计的基石。它回答了“用户使用应用时应该获得何等感受”这个问题。首先,你应该确定你的主要目标人群或者产业是哪些:儿童,青少年,专业人士,妈妈,手机APP开发,学生,医生,设计师,老年人,等等。应用的设计风格必须与品牌相一致,这样才能建立更强的品牌认知,并消除用户疑虑。例如,APP软件开发,为老年人设计的社交应用就应该用大号字体,而交易应用就得有策略地使用安全锁图标来让用户有安全感。如果可能,你还该考虑为品牌找一个吉祥物。吉祥物可以将品牌拟人化,同时强化应用留给用户的印象。
你的APP是做什么的一旦确定开发的目标和平台,团队就可以开始考虑APP所要表现出来的功能性。无论是移动购物或者提交费用报表,目的一致是非常关键的。应用程序对于用户来说就像是一个“集成池”,这意味着他们也可以在其上使用其他产品,就像一家综合性网站一样,能把其他的程序集中在一起。例如,如今的亚马逊手机APP,就增加了合理化的“立即购买”,不单单只是阅读评论、产品情况和客户服务。同样的方法也可以用在内部商务处理的APP上。比起建立一个APP,只独立处理文件授权,费用反馈或病假处理,把这些需求集成在一起更会有效率。作为一家手机软件开发公司,要充分根据用户的需求制定目标。可以通过分析移动设备用户浏览现有各种服务网站的行为分析来确定目标。
零七网部分新闻及文章转载自互联网,供读者交流和学习,若有涉及作者版权等问题请及时与我们联系,以便更正、删除或按规定办理。感谢所有提供资讯的网站,欢迎各类媒体与零七网进行文章共享合作。